What does the etymology of a word or phrase include?

Answer:

<u>Etymology</u> is a branch of linguistics that studies the history and origin of a linguistic form (words, phrases, etc.) and deals with its development since its earliest recorded occurrence in language. Therefore, the etymology of a word or phrase includes the origin of a word and the derivations created throught its transmission.
